14:22 — Stale pricing data reported on the Lumenshop catalog. Cache invalidation events from the Pricewright service stopped propagating after the queue consumer stalled at 13:58. Restarting the consumer cleared the backlog within six minutes; affected SKUs re-rendered correctly by 14:31. No customer orders were placed at stale prices. Root cause: a deadlocked worker thread in the invalidation fanout. The offending build is identified below.

pipeline stamp: htk4_ae36

Hello plugin authors,

Next Thursday, Corbexa will run a disaster-recovery drill for the RestockRoute vending-machine restock planner. During the failover window, plugin callbacks will be replayed against the standby scheduler, so please ensure your handlers are idempotent and tolerate duplicate route assignments. No customer restock data will be altered. To re-register your plugin against the standby environment during the drill, authenticate with the recovery passphrase provided below.

vault phrase of hahip-tajeg = quenax-briath-briax

**Ticket #4412 — Loyalty ledger reconciliation, needs sign-off**

Heads up: the Perkstack ledger double-credited points on refunded orders last sprint. Fix is merged and the correction script dry-ran clean on staging. We just need release sign-off before Friday's cut, since it touches customer balances. Please don't ship without approval from the owner listed below.

signatory, baweg-bahip: Sildor Aldath Caseth